Output d82a70156b6b6258c7263d552f84f8846d64a7984a1d525d53cee6c6daaec38b:1

value
15850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1df88cafd404cfd7afd7f7e68a18e6a2653d93ef OP_EQUAL
address
9uAk1Uj9PD5e6JsSACE4GBj3pqwNYxzoWu
transaction
d82a70156b6b6258c7263d552f84f8846d64a7984a1d525d53cee6c6daaec38b